What Is Your Free Time Worth to
You?
Businesses
that provide commercial cleaning services have indicated that there are varied
types of clients: those who have in-office cleaners come in every day or once
or twice a week, and those who just want a periodical deep cleaning. These are
the types of things you’ll wish to cast out with a professional cleaner
beforehand. If you have children and pets inside the house and visitors coming
to the office, you might want to choose a weekly cleaning option, depending
upon your cleaning budget. Most companies choose 3-4 times a month, with a deep
cleaning once or twice. A deep home or office cleaning also involves cleaning
hard-to-reach areas like behind heavy equipment, under furniture, and so on.
Even Daily Is an Option
For companies
that are always having visitors, or families that have small children, a daily
in-house cleaner might be a helpful option, at least for a while. This will
also be the option for elderly people who will need extra help with regular
cleaning tasks.
The Dent in Your Bank Statement
Most
commercial cleaning companies are willing to provide you a good deal if you
hire them more than once a month. There are certain variables to think about,
such as the size of your home, and what precisely you want your in-office
cleaner to do. Some cleaning companies in Singapore charge by the space or square
foot. For instance, if the cleaning services charge S$1 for every 10 square
feet, and you have a 3,000-square-foot office, you’ll have to pay S$300 per
cleaning session.
Things to Keep in Mind
·
Ensure that the cleaning company you recruited
is insured
·
Talk about the cleaning materials they’ll be
applying, or even if they have cleaning materials at all. You may be asked to
provide them or pay for them
·
Ask the company if they check the backgrounds
of their employees
·
Go through any reviews they might have, or
even ask for testimonials
How
to clean hard-to-reach spaces?
Blinds and Tongs
A very
creative idea is to get a pair of cooking tongs and have elastics to bind damp,
lint-free clothes around them. It’s a fantastic way to unsoil the slats of the
blinds.
Window Frames
One of the
banes of an office cleaner’s existence, window frames are difficult to clean
well. But, if you insert an empty toilet paper tube on the mouth of your
vacuum’s suction tube, sucking all that dirt out will become a piece of cake.
It might surprise you to learn this, but most upholstery cleaning services in Singapore use this simple yet
effective technique.
Computer Keyboard
To conduct an
easy-clean, just fold a piece of gummy notepaper in half with the sticky side
putting outwards and progress it between the keys on your keyboard to get the
crumbs and dust.
A Fresh Mattress
Mattresses
can be difficult to keep fresh, but they shouldn’t be. Just sprinkle baking
soda on the overall surface, wait for 15-20 minutes or so, and vacuum clean it
all using your vacuum’s crevice tool.
